Every state has own insurance requirements. It is strongly recommended to get acquainted with all of the insurance laws and requirements before purchasing the policy since this is the only way to understand what kind of the policy you need to buy. You have to do that even though you just need to renew the existing policy.

However, in some of the states it is not mandatory to purchase the auto insurance policy. But before making that decision you have to be sure that you can easily prove financial responsibility.

Every state has own auto insurance laws that has to be strongly obeyed. Usually the driver is requited to have the minimal coverage. This coverage can be helpful in case of the small damages or injuries. If the situation is more serious such as an accident the minimal coverage is not enough. If you are looking for the quality insurance policy getting and comparing quotes is the only way to identify that type of it. There is no doubt that it is very important to ask for more information about the insurance quotes before picking the most appropriate auto insurance.

In such states where the insurance policy is not mandatory if the driver is involved into the car accident he has to prove that he has enough money to cover all of the expenses. Usually the expenses are so high that it will cause driver much bigger troubles than he could have with purchasing the insurance policy. There are a couple of ways to prove that you are able to cover the expenses in case you are involved into the auto accident. The first way is to buy an insurance policy. If it is not an option for you then you can put some money on the deposit in order to meet the state requirements. And the last way is to fill up the form to show that you have sufficient amount of money that will be available for covering the damages.

If you decided to purchase the insurance policy that you have to make sure that the coverage meets the minimal requirements of the state. Sometimes it seems that there is a little possibility that you can be involved into the car accident. However, during the last years the traffic became so heavy that it became vitally important to purchase the auto insurance policy that will protect us in case of the accident. Even though in some states the insurance is not mandatory it is still recommended to buy one because even you can prove the financial responsibility, you may be not able to cover all of the damages and body injuries. As a result you can become a bankrupt.

Seniors Life Insurance: Six Points to Contemplate

November 30th, 2009

b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ark

The Canadian marketplace has altered greatly for seniors hunting for life insurance. Although insurance companies look more closely at applications the actual charges, in most cases, are a lot lower.

For the older generation taking out life insurance, there are six points to consider.

1. Insurance no longer stops being accessible to the younger generation, it can presently be bought up to the age of 85. What you need to be mindful of, is there can be a big difference in the premiums available the older you get. What a lot of individuals fail to consider is the best time to obtain life insurance is now, that’s because you are looking at today’s rate.

2. Face amounts can be as small as $5,000 and charges can be as small as $20/month. You can get an instant quote for traditional life insurance at our instant life insurance quote page.

3. Many creditor insurance plans end at age 69. Individuals who are coming up to retirement or are currently retired and in good health should consider individual life insurance options instead of creditor insurance.

4. If you lucky enough to be in tip top health with an excellent family health history you could probably qualify for the preferred rates.

5. Most insurance companies now supply last-to-die coverage at a lower rate than traditional life insurance. Insurance like this pays the money out when the final surviving spouse passes on and it pays out a tax-free death benefit to the estate. It’s because the the insurance monies are paid out further in the future that the price are substantially less.

6. If your health isn’t the best then consider the Simplified Issue policies that are around. These schemes do not have medical examinations, but they do have health questions. The applicant should make sure that they select a scheme that carries the biggest number of health questions they can say no to. Policies with no health questions carry the highest costs (since it bunches together the insured people with the poorest health) and these plans have a two-year waiting period for the death benefit.

You Really Need Building Insurance Because Of Several Reasons. Read About Them Here

November 30th, 2009

b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ark bookmark

In most cases it is required to insure your house before you can take out a mortgage. This is one of the common reasons why people are purchasing building insurance. But if you have paid for your property fully or don’t need a mortgage, there are still plenty of reasons for you to insure your property. You surely know that our life is full of unforeseen situations, and no one can say for sure what will be tomorrow. Many people who suffer damage to their property or even lose it entirely don’t even expect these things to happen.

Different disasters happen with people’s property every day, but fortunately we have a means of protection – building insurance. In case something happens to your house or other property that is under coverage of your insurance, the insurance provider is obliged to cover the cost of loss for you, if it goes in accordance with the terms and conditions of the deal. Moreover, if somebody inside your house sustains an injury (guests, repairmen, domestic servants, etc), they will receive money from the insurance provider in order to cover their loss.

If you don’t get building insurance on time, you might have serious problems later. It is extremely unpleasant and painful to be forced to sell your house in order to cover damage to people who got it in your house. Your house is probably one of the most important things in your life, and you can’t afford to put it at risk. Besides, if you lose your house through the authorities, this can pose a serious risk to you and your family’s financial life in future.

You have to understand as well that there are some things which cannot be replaced. Even if you receive the actual cost of photographs that have been destroyed by fire or flood, you won’t be bale to gain back the sentimental value these photographs represent. You have to be very careful with your dearest things.

You have to take both building and contents insurance in order to secure your house from the outside and from the inside. For covering things like garage, greenhouse, sheds, etc, you have to make an additional claim. In general, try not to miss out anything important, make a list and discuss it with a consultant. You have to know how much all of these things cost and how much money you will need to replace them in case of loss. You have to include and evaluate absolutely everything that can be lost or damaged.

One more piece of advice – install various security devices into your house, and this may considerably lower your premium, as many insurance providers have more confidence in property that is protected better.
